About 485 Park Avenue
This handsome, 14-story building was erected in 1922 and converted to a cooperative in 1945.
It has a three-story limestone base and light-beige brick facades with an attractive, canopied entrance with bronze doors and sidewalk landscaping. The building, which replaced some garages, has only 23 apartments.
It has a superb location that is very convenient to the midtown office and shopping districts and public transportation. It has inconsistent fenestration and some protruding air-conditioners, but its lobby is very elegant and the apartment layouts are fine.
